Safe to enlarge nose holes on Resmed f30
hi, I have been trying to use my new mask, a Resmed f30. Sort of a hybrid full face mask. The nasal holes are distinct but seem small for the size of my nares and leave me feeling like my breathing is obstructed. 
Is it possible to “ cut away” a bit of the nasal mask part to enlarge the holes?
If so, any recommendations on how to go about it?
Thanks for any help you might share.

RE: Safe to enlarge nose holes on Resmed f30
I cut the little piece of silicone between the F30 nasal holes all the time. Nothing bad to report so far. I have not however tried to enlarge the individual holes. As SleepRider said, make sure you have the properly sized mask.

If you like the mask form factor and want larger holes, consider the F&P Evora full-face mask. Similar to the F30, but with a firmer nose rest and larger holes. I have no experience with the F40, so cannot comment on that mask, but based on what I have read it seems closer to the Evora than the F30.
